Understanding the Game Mechanics
The mines game operates on a simple yet engaging premise, where players navigate a grid filled with concealed prizes and lurking mines. Each player selects a cell to “open,” and based on their choice, they may either uncover a prize or trigger a mine, effectively ending their turn. The game typically allows for multiple rounds, and players can strategize how many cells to reveal before making a decision.
To better grasp how this game operates, it’s beneficial to look at the grid layout and possible outcomes. The following table provides a glimpse into the mechanics at play and the various rewards or consequences associated with each type of cell:
Prize Cell | A cell that contains a reward, increasing the player’s total winnings. |
Mine Cell | A cell that, when opened, results in the loss of the player’s bet. |
Safe Cell | A non-reward, non-mine cell that allows the player to continue playing. |
Each cell holds the potential for a rewarding experience or a disheartening setback. The game is designed to challenge players to weigh their options and consider the risks involved in each choice they make. Understanding these mechanics better prepares players for the challenges ahead.

The Role of Probability Analysis
Another essential component of mastering the mines game is understanding probability analysis. Successful players often approach the game with a mathematical mindset, evaluating the likelihood of various outcomes based on the game state.
Probability dictates the decisions players make; for instance, knowing the ratio of mines to safe cells can inform how boldly one might play. If a player knows there are more safe cells in a certain area of the grid, they may choose to reveal them first before venturing into riskier spots.
Moreover, calculating probabilities can vary depending on the total number of cells and mines in play. Players who succeed are usually those who can adapt their strategies based on changing probabilities throughout the game, allowing them to optimize their winnings while minimizing losses.
